Self Storage Employment Opportunities for Extra Income in Rural Areas

If there is one thing that people in rural areas share it is a relatively limited economy within the conventional workforce and plenty of space. As such, if you live in a rural area, a very common way of making anything from a few extra bucks to quite a comfortable income are self storage employment opportunities.

Generally these fall into a few general categories. Firstly, you may find yourself working for an established company as an on-site caretaker. Often companies will hire couples to actually live on the premises and maintain as well as guard the lockers. Such self storage employment opportunities usually are very much like taking a part time job as an apartment manager, and the lodgings are usually in mobile homes or trailers.

Other types of self storage employment opportunities are those you make for yourself. This may involve the purchase of an existing self storage facility. In such cases it is a good idea to find out just why the people who built or leased the facility are getting out of the business. It is not generally a good idea to leap into a business venture that you are not already familiar with and just assume you'll be able to do better than the previous owners.

In these cases, you'll very often be working for or with a larger chain or corporation that sets the rates and requires a regular tithe to the corporate gods. This doesn't always sit well with independent rural folks who want to really make a go at self storage employment opportunities of their own, but can involve the often lucrative income involved with cross country rental trucks, too.

Of course, there's nothing about self storage employment opportunities that says you can't start it up yourself and do a very good business, indeed. It does require a certain amount of startup capital, but since self storage is something that nearly every community requires, if there's a need in your area, even starting out small, you have a very good chance of expanding into a larger enterprise soon by reinvesting your initial profits into expansion.

In most communities, the major concern with self storage employment opportunities is the cost of initial start up as well as the cost of security. However, with good design and some initial thought given to the physical plant of the storage units, you can rest a bit easier. People also often locate these facilitates near their homes so they can keep an eye on things, with or without canine help.
